Production tracking
Runs, batches, yields, and downtime recorded per line, per shift, per machine.
Quality management
Inspections, non-conformances, CAPA, and the audit trail your certification depends on.
Maintenance & asset records
Planned and reactive maintenance, asset history, and parts — per machine, with the full service record.
Shift handover & workflows
Structured handovers, escalations, and sign-offs that survive the change of shift.
OEE dashboards
Availability, performance, and quality — the real numbers, per line and per shift.

Fault diagnosis from history
Ask what's wrong and Castia searches every past fault, repair, and shift note for the machine — the retired engineer's knowledge is still in the system.
Search the manuals
"How do I reset the tolerance on line 3?" — the answer pulled from page 212 of the OEM manual, in seconds.
Downtime analysis
Not just how much downtime — which root cause, how often, and what it's costing per line.
Maintenance agents
An agent that watches the pattern and raises the work order before the failure, not after.
Ask the plant
"Why did yield drop on line 2 last week?" — reconciled across production logs, quality data, and maintenance records.
